Development of Sand Ripple Meter - Basic Experiments on Ultrasonic Characteristics in Sea Bottom Sand-

Executive Summary

The ultrasonic sand rippler meter that is buried under the sea bottom is developed for measuring the profile of sand ripples.
 The results are as follows:
(1)The interface between the sea water and the sand bottom can be detected in the bed.
(2)The sound velocity, the propagation frequency, and the damping constant in the bottom sand where a part of the void is filled with the air are compared with those in the sand where the void is entirely filled with the water.
(3)The system of the sand ripple meter has been designed based on the experimental data.
